Can 64-bit run on 2GB RAM?
Should I install 32-bit or 64-bit on 2GB RAM?
Running short of RAM causes increased disk activity, which slows down the PC. I would not run 64-bit Windows on a PC with 2GB of RAM and 32-bit Windows will have more room to work because it is smaller. Windows 10 system requirements
- Latest OS: Make sure you're running the latest version—either Windows 7 SP1 or Windows 8.1 Update. ...
- Processor: 1 gigahertz (GHz) or faster processor or SoC.
- RAM: 1 gigabyte (GB) for 32-bit or 2 GB for 64-bit.
- Hard disk space: 16 GB for 32-bit OS or 20 GB for 64-bit OS.
Is 2GB RAM OK on PC?
2GB RAM. For modern Windows computers, 2GB of RAM will feel slow. You won't be able to run many programs simultaneously, much less have more than a few browser tabs open at one time. How to change 32bit to 64bit?
Upgrade Windows 10 From 32-Bit to 64-Bit
- Check your CPU compatibility with 64-bit architecture.
- Determine driver and system compatibility with 64-bit architecture.
- Create a new installation media with a USB flash drive.
- Boot Windows from the installation media.
- Follow the setup and install the 64-bit version of Windows 10.

Can you put 8GB RAM with 2GB RAM?
Most laptops or computers come with at least two slots for RAM sticks, if not more. Most modern motherboards will provide four RAM slots. There's a prevailing misconception you cannot use different RAM sizes together or that you cannot mix RAM brands. Simply put, that's not true.
